YOUR SCIENCE FACT OF THE DAY: Mammatus Clouds

Writer's picture: Classic City NewsClassic City News

Mammatus clouds are actually other types of clouds (usually altocumulus, cirrus, or cumulonimbus) that are unique because they present with pouch-like shapes on their undersides.

These characteristic pouches are created when cold air inside the cloud sinks downward towards the Earth’s surface. Mammatus clouds often indicate that severe weather is on the way.
